  • Title

    Voltage transformer ferroresonance from an energy transfer standpoint

  • Abstract
    A novel approach to determine whether ferroresonance can occur is developed. It is based on the energy transferred from the system to the voltage transformer during the switching transient. This approach is used to develop a practical test criterion to indicate if ferroresonance can occur at a specific station. The numerical values of the parameters used in this criteria can be easily determined for any station. The analytical results are compared with experimental data gathered at three stations on the AEP system with good agreement
